53:119 Hydrology
Problem #14
Philips Infiltration Equation

A soil has a sorptivity (S) of 5 cm hr-1/2 and a hydraulic conductivity (K) of 0.4 cm/hr.  Predict the infiltration and cumulative infiltration curves for a constant intensity rainstorm with rainrate i of 6 cm/hr.

  1. Ponding time tp (hours)
  2. Cumulative infiltration at ponding (cm)
  3. Equivalent time origin t0 (hours)
  4. Compute the actual infiltration rate f (cm/hr) at 0, 10, 20, ..., 60 minutes.
  5. Compute the actual cumulative infiltration F (cm) at 0, 10, 20, ..., 60 minutes.
  6. Plot the actual infiltration rate as a function of time (one plot). Be sure to include time tp as a point and label the ponding time on the curve.
  7. Plot the actual cumulative infiltration as a function of time (a second plot). Be sure to include time tp as a point and label the ponding time on the curve.
